      Meaning of the first name Shirlee

      Origin

      English

      Meaning

      Bright Meadow

      Variations

      Shirley, Charlee, Shareef
      The name Shirlee has its origins in the English language and carries the meaning of Bright Meadow. This particular name reflects the cultural and geographical influences prevalent in England, where meadows hold significant importance and beauty. Throughout history, Shirlee has been a frequently chosen name for girls, often associated with qualities such as vibrancy, tranquility, and natural beauty.

      Based on our records...

      Did you know?

      1935 is when there were the most people born with the first name Shirlee.
